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Champaign County
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Champaign County?
Actualmente hay 655 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Champaign County, IL con precios que van desde $525 hasta $3,400. También hay 106 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Champaign County que van desde $525 hasta $3,950.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Champaign County?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Champaign County oscilan entre $525 hasta $3,950 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,319.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Champaign County?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Champaign County oscilan entre $780 hasta $3,400,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,225 hasta $3,800.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,395 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$780.
